This trip will be an immersive experience in the world’s largest, most biodiverse rainforest – we will arrive in the extraordinary city of Iquitos – the world’s largest city that is inaccessible by car and spend the night in the city centre  before setting of the following morning over 100km downstream to a remote lodge where we will base ourselves for five nights with multiple excursions by foot and by boat in search of wildlife, after five nights we will return to Iquitos and head over 100km upriver towards the Pacaya- Samiria Reserve where we will spend another five nights before heading back to overnight in Iquitos and leave the next day.

We will be immersed in the wildlife of the world’s greatest river, accompanied by expert local guides we hope to see sloths, squirrel monkeys, howler monkeys, marmosets, river dolphins, poison arrow frogs, caiman, river otters, anacondas, macaws, extraordinary birds, giant waterlilies, orchids, ferns, palms & tarantulas.  We will canoe through the flooded forest, visit native communities to learn about their customs and cultures, drink rum in a wild distillery, learn about medicinal plants, swim in lakes and the Amazon River, go for night walks and see the stars, trek and camp out in the rainforest, fish for piranhas.   The days, and indeed nights, will be packed with activities, however as we will be based out of two lodges activities will be optional.
